Job Description

Role overview:

White Goods EngineerStevenage Stevenage Customer Service Centre Permanent Full Time

Salary: 32-38k 

Shift Pattern:  5 over 7 Days

Counties : Bedfordshire, Hertfordshire, North London, North West London, Enfield 

At Currys we’re united by one passion: to help everyone enjoy amazing technology. As the UK’s best-known retailer of tech, we’re proud of the service our customers receive – and it’s all down to our team of 25,000 caring and committed colleagues. So you’ll never go it alone here.  You’ll work in a great team, learning and growing together, and celebrating the big and small moments that make every day amazing.

Join us as a White Goods Engineer and you’ll work your magic to keep customers’ appliances in tip-top condition. Whether you’re installing, diagnosing faults or making a vital repair, you’ll be on hand with the right skills, right knowledge and plenty of smiles to make sure every experience is a great one.

Role overview:

As part of this role, you’ll be responsible for:  ?    Driving your company van and managing your own day effectively (as you’ll work mainly on your own).?    Testing, diagnosing and fixing white goods in our customers’ homes.?    Providing and implementing technical knowledge across a range of white goods appliances.?    Building up our reputation as a home services expert.

A lot of the job comes down to skill and efficiency, but building a rapport with customers is just as important. They will welcome you into their homes, and it’ll be down to you to get their products back on track and put their minds at ease. 

You will need:?    Proven experience in White Goods repairs.?    Full UK/EU driving licence with no more than 6 penalty points.?    Ideally (but not essential) ACS Qualifications (or equivalent) in Essential Gas Safety Domestic (CCN1), Gas Cookers and Ranges (CKR1).?    To love that feeling when you’ve delivered for a customer.

We know our people are the secret to our success. That’s why we’re always looking for ways to reward great work. Alongside 30 days of annual leave (including bank holiday entitlement) and a competitive pension scheme, you’ll find a host of benefits designed to work for you. They include:?    First-class induction and on-going learning.?    Company approved tools and van.?    A shift pattern of five over seven days.?    Quarterly bonus.?    Product discounts across the latest tech.
